You have deployed a Java application to Cloud Run. Your application requires access to a database hosted on Cloud SQL. Due to regulatory requirements, your connection to the Cloud SQL instance must use its internal IP address. How should you configure the connectivity while following Google-recommended best practices?

A. Configure your Cloud Run service with a Cloud SQL connection.

B. Configure your Cloud Run service to use a Serverless VPC Access connector.

C. Configure your application to use the Cloud SQL Java connector.

D. Configure your application to connect to an instance of the Cloud SQL Auth proxy.








 

Correct Answer: C
